    Wifey has just organised an Incentive Saver Account in her name.

    The Welcome Pack comes out to you within 3-5 days and the pack includes a form for you to convert the account into a Joint Account. Apparently, this has to be sent back to Lloyds TSB by post.

    Apparently, one can only participate in ONE Incentive Saver Account, be it either a Joint or a Personal Account so we will be deliberating on what to do here. I understand, but am not sure on it, but our Phone Adviser told my wife that the interest rate is a Fixed Rate and fixed for 1 year, rather than it being Variable rate.

    I might feel it best that we leave it as it is, ie. only in her name for the time being, and then organise one in my name a few months down the road. We'll have a read of the Welcome Pack when it comes.

    Although she only rang up about it and opened it today, the account should be up and running on Monday, 27th June, and accessible Online, and also able to be additionally funded with Transfers from the other Vantage Accounts on Monday too.

    10_66 wrote: »
    When I asked LTSB about non activity on the Vantage accounts, I was told that if there wasn't any activity on it for "a while", it would be suspended. When I asked them if "a while" is around a year, they said about that.
    The dormancy period is actually 3 years. If there are no customer generated transactions in this period (i.e credit interest isn't activity) then the account becomes dormant.
